Adhere To Laws On Mineral Exploration, Kwara Gov Tells Citizens

Date: 2023-02-17

Kwara State governor, A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q yesterday called for adherence to relevant laws of the land in mineral exploration in Kwara north and other parts of the state.

AbdulRazaq spoke when the All Progressives Congress (APC) campaign team visited the district head of Lade community, Alh Abubakar Haruna in Patigi local government area.

“I congratulate you that God has made you find wealth on your land. I want to urge Your Highness and the entire community to manage the resources very well. The powers on solid minerals are vested in the federal government. So, while you are doing it, you should follow relevant laws and do what you are doing peacefully for the benefit of the state,”

“I have seen progress unlike before in Lade. So, there would be much pressure from outside and within, unlike before. I urge you to prioritise peace.

“On the issues raised by His Royal Highness, we will address them one after the other. On the issue of doctors at Cottage Hospital and the ongoing road construction at the dispensary, we will get the contractors to do all necessary things, “ the governor stated.

On the desilting of Lade irrigation dam, AbdulRazaq urged the community leaders to forward their request for immediate attention.

“I am glad that His Royal Highness raised the issue of irrigation farming. You did not abandon farming because of the discovery of lithium. I urge you to continue to do the right things,” he added.
